Rising hip hop artist/world music and a producer, Viesta was born in Bamako, Mali.

The younger of two sons born to a history teacher, and a homemaker, Viesta was a model student who dsiplayed a passion for history, philosophy and writing very early on. As a child, he dreamed of following in his father’s footsteps and becoming teacher; however, the gift of a radio and microphone changed him and his dream forever.

In a recent interview, Viesta describes the experiences that led him to hip hop: “You know, I think it all started with this little yellow radio and microphone that my father bought me. When I got it, a coup d’etat had just been staged in Mali and the first Gulf War was going on. So I decided I’d be a reporter, and would go around my neighborhood reporting the news and telling stories. When I got tired of that, I used the same radio to play my older brother’s Bob Marley tapes, and used my microphone to record my own version of the songs. (laughs) I didn’t understand a word [Bob Marley] was saying, but I could tell from the energy and passion in his voice, that he was saying something important. I knew I wanted to make other people feel the way I felt when I heard his music. Shortly after that, I heard hip hop for the first time, Kriss Kross and something just clicked.”

Encouraged by his childhood friend, Tawati, Viesta continued to sharpen his skills throughout high school, performing at parties and local talent showcases. However, it’s in the early 2000's, when he moved to New York, that his musical style truly blossomed. There, he became a skilled producer/sound engineer and developed a unique sound reflecting his diverse musical influences, including 2pac, Bob Marley, Nina Simone, James Brown, Fela Kuti, John Lee Hooker, Salif Keita, Al Green to name a few. In 2004, he began recording, producing and performing his own music in venues and festivals throughout New York City. Since that time, he has developed a strong following, and is believed by some to be the future of Malien Hip hop.

Unafraid to stretch boundaries, Viesta masterfully blends elements of Afrobeat, Zouk, Hip Hop, R&B, Jazz, Reggae, Rock, Blues and Traditional Malien sounds within his music. Listeners will find a little of everything on his debut album, “Fatimata,” including impressive lyrical acrobatics in English, French and in his native, Bambara.
